Screwdriver Attack: Man Appears In Court Page last updated 09:29AM Saturday April 27, 2013 A man has been remanded in custody charged with the attempted murder of a headteacher who was stabbed with a screwdriver outside her home. Gillian Kay, 39, head of Propps Hall Primary School in Failsworth, Oldham, received injuries to her face and neck in the assault in Rochdale on Thursday afternoon. Mark Pierson, 48, of Belfield Old Road, Rochdale, appeared before Bury and Rochdale Magistrates in a brief hearing. He will next appear at Manchester Minshull Street Crown Court on May 17 for a preliminary hearing. Ms Kay was attacked as she got out of her car in Shaw Road, Thornham, just after 5pm. Police were called to the scene following reports she been stabbed three times. The court heard on Saturday she had received treatment for nine stab wounds. The headteacher was airlifted to hospital and was in a serious condition but has since been released from hospital.

Las Vegas Shooting: Suspect May Face Death Page last updated 13:06PM Saturday April 27, 2013 Sky News US Team The suspect in the fatal shooting and fiery crash that killed three people on the Las Vegas Strip has been indicted on charges that could carry the death penalty. A Clark County District Court grand jury indicted 27-year-old Ammar Harris on three counts of murder, one count of attempted murder and seven counts of discharging a weapon. Harris, self-described pimp, is accused of shooting from a black Range Rover into a Maserati sports car that then slammed into a taxi that burst into flames in February. Taxi driver Michael Boldon, 62, and passenger Sandra Sutton-Wasmund, were killed. The Maserati driver, 27-year-old rapper, Kenny Clutch, died at hospital. In an unexpected move, the grand jury also indicted Harris on a charge of robbery and three felony sex assault counts in a 2010 rape case that had been dismissed last year when the alleged victim refused to testify. Quinnipiac Poll: Gun Issue Boosts Toomey Approval Written by Keegan Gibson, Managing Editor Sen. Pat Toomey's approval rating is its highest ever according to the latest survey from Quinnipiac University. The jump was driven by his high profile on a recent bill to expand background checks. 48% approve of the way the freshman Republican is handling his job in the Senate; 30% disapprove. He is in positive territory among every single demographic subdivision the pollster measured, including Democrats (41% to 34%).
